Joliet, IL vs Wicker Park, IL
| Category | Joliet, IL | Wicker Park, IL |
|---|---|---|
| Housing | ||
| Verdict | Think twice | Good for now |
| Median Price | $171K ✓ Lower price | $617K |
| Median Rent | $1K ✓ Lower rent | $2K |
| Median Income | $61K | $119K ✓ Higher income |
| Price Volatility | Moderate | Moderate |
| Getting Around | ||
| Walk Score | 2/100 | 78/100 ✓ More walkable |
| Transit Score | Minimal transit | 46/100 ✓ Better transit |
| Bike Score | N/A | 80/100 ✓ More bikeable |
| Commute | 61 min | 10 min ✓ Shorter commute |
| Safety & Environment | ||
| Safety Grade | D+ | D+ |
| Violent Crime | Moderate | Moderate |
| Property Crime | Moderate | Moderate |
| Flood Risk | High | Low ✓ Lower risk |
| Air Quality | Moderate | Moderate |
| Community | ||
| Schools | 6.2/10 | 6.9/10 ✓ Better schools |
| Best for | Budget buyersFamilies seeking affordable homesCommuters willing to drive to Chicago | young professionalscreative typesstudents |
Bottom line
For budget buyers seeking a low-cost place to live, Joliet might be a viable option despite its drawbacks. However, for young professionals and families prioritizing a vibrant community and convenient amenities, Wicker Park is likely a better fit due to its high walk score, better schools, and shorter commute to Chicago.
